Physiology & Pathology Sciences is the 93rd most popular major in the country with 8,385 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, physiology and pathology sciences gra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$32,215 and had an average of $29,778 in loans still to pay off.

Across Wisconsin, there were 155 physiology and pathology sciences gra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,700 and $28,199 respectively. Marquette University

Milwaukee, Wisconsin

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Physiology Schools for a Bachelor’s in Wisconsin For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, Marquette University landed the #1 spot on the list. Marquette University is a private not-for-profit institution located in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 80 bachelors’s degrees in 2019-2020.

Marquette not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best Physiology & Pathology Sciences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Wisconsin” list. The estimated yearly cost for Marquette University is $25,492 for Wisconsin Bachelor’s Degree Physiology students whose families make $48-$75k.

The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 88%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The student loan default rate at the school is 1.5%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Concordia University, Wisconsin.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value Physiology Schools for a Bachelor’s in Wisconsin For Those Making $48-$75k. Concordia University, Wisconsin is a medium-sized school located in Mequon, Wisconsin that handed out 14 bachelors’s physiology degrees in 2019-2020.

Concordia University, Wisconsin also made our “Best Physiology & Pathology Sciences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Wisconsin” list, coming in at #2. The yearly cost to attend Concordia University, Wisconsin is $21,624 for Wisconsin Bachelor’s Degree Physiology students whose families make $48-$75k.

The school has an impressive student loan default rate. It’s only 4.6%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.
